The Schindler 3300 Solar is all about the benefits of self-supplying energy
management. The elevator can be operated by a grid and photovoltaic-panels
that contribute to an autonomously operated building.
Plug-and-go integration
220 / 230 V single phase
1600 W input power
MC4 PV-panel connection
The solar elevator can be plugged in just like any kitchen
appliance and functions with a standard PV-panel interface.
A three-phase building interface is not required. It is
engineered for quick integration into the building power
system.

Whenever there is sunlight the batteries will be charged with solar
energy. Different charging modes make it possible to respond to
traffic-flow requirements of the building and extra grid charging
in low traffic periods. Even grid supplied expensive power peaks
are a thing of the past.
* Based on a Life Cycle Assessment for a representative configuration and over a
life-time of 15 years. Results consider a 50% energy supply with solar energy per year.
Global Warming Potential according to IPCC 2007 / GWP 100a in CO2e.

The Solar energy supply is kept at a maximum by the smart Hybrid Power
Manager, a new component that controls energy supply and is able to store
energy for a long-lasting clean operation. This assures continuous operation
and CO2 savings.
Non-stop availability
400 trips
40 h standby
6.9 kWh capacity
Continuous elevator operation, even if there is a power failure.
The accumulators have outstanding capacity and long-life
performance. The elevator is based on the proven Schindler 3300
platform for reliability.
No wasted power
Up to 25% energy
recuperation into the
Hybrid Power Manager
Energy that is not needed to operate the elevator will be used
to charge the accumulators. Less energy from the grid also means
less emissions.

The Schindler 3300 Solar is designed and planned to be operated as conveniently as the standard Schindler 3300 model. The dual power supply is
enabled by the Hybrid Power Manager (HPM) and is easy to install and connect.
Reliable technology
The Schindler 3300 Solar uses the same
technology as the regular Schindler 3300
elevator. It comes equipped with all the
plus points – the lubrication-free gearless
drive, the innovative traction media and
design varieties.
Hybrid Power
The Hybrid Power Manager is the new
operative core of the Schindler 3300
Solar. It controls the flow of energy
and stores the power that operates the
elevator. All power is regulated by the
HPM and it can be located somewhere
in the building in a closed room with a
maximum distance of 27 m to the drive
system.

The Schindler 3300 Solar offers various modes that secure a non-stop
operation and aims at optimizing the solar energy supply.
Sun charges battery
Whenever sunlight is available the accumulators
will be exclusively* charged via this power source.
This mode is consistant with the aim to keep the
accumulators continuously charged.
Operation Mode 1
Sun charges battery
Electricity grid
Supply by accumulators
The elevator will always be supplied by the
accumulators, there is no direct connection either
to the grid or the PV-panels. In case the capacity
reaches a certain level, re-charging will start via
the grid until the accumulators are fully charged.
As the system is smart grid ready, grid charging
can also be pre-set at times with low cost energy
tariffs.
Operation Mode 2
Battery supply
Regenerative supply
Energy gets recuperated into the accumulators
whenever it is not being used to operate the
elevators e.g. in case of light loads traveling
downwards.
Operation Mode 3
Regenerative supply
Electricity
grid
Electricity grid supply
The accumulators will also be charged from the
electrical building grid. In case of low capacity and
depending on the settings the charging will be
activated. Once it is started it will continue until
the accumulators are fully charged.

HSG HSK(1) HSK(2) Interfloor distance (HE) is:
min. 2400mm for door height 2000mm/ min. 2500mm for door height 2100mm/ min. 2700 mm
for door height 2300mm
HE for two-stop installations is min. 2600mm for door height 2000mm and 2100mm.
The short interfloor distance (HE min.) for opposite entrances is 300mm.
